Notes on using the input selector buttons

Note that pressing on each input selector button selects
the source which is connected to the corresponding input
terminals on the rear panel.

The selection of TAPE MONITOR or VCR MONITOR
cannot be canceled by pressing another input selector
button. To cancel it, press it again.

In step 3, if two or more program sources are selected at
the same time, be sure to remember the priority order of
the input sources.
Priority order of sources: 1) TAPE MONITOR, 2) VCR
MONITOR
, 3) LD/TV, TUNER, CD or PHONO.
* If you select LD/TV, TUNER, CD or PHONO, be sure

that neither TAPE MONITOR nor VCR MONITOR have
been selected.

* If you select TAPE MONITOR and VCR MONITOR and

another input selector button at the same time, the
playback result will be the video image from the VCR
and the sound from the audio tape.

* If you select both LD/TV and TAPE MONITOR at the

same time, the playback result will be the video image
from the LD player and the sound from the audio tape.

* Once you play the LD player, its video image will not be

interrupted even if other input selector buttons except
VCR MONITOR are selected.
